Ryan Murphy dropped a bomb on American Horror Story fans when he confirmed in October that all seasons of the hit series are connected. The audience had surmised and fiddled with such an idea, but now it was all substantiated. According to Murphy, Season 2 (Asylum) is connected to Season 4 (Freak Show), which is connected to Season 1 (Murder House). He didn€™t specify how all of that relates to Season 3 (Coven), but that€™s not stopping anybody. Audiences should know what the theme for Season 5 is around March - that's when Murphy announced the theme for Freak Show last year - which might grant a little more insight into ways the stories are connected. Until then, however, there are four other seasons to dig into. Wild theories have been shared over lattes in coffee shops, fans have developed timelines and family trees, and the American Horror Story Wikia is bursting at the seams with posts from fans trying to figure it all out. The creators did give the audience a few easy connections in this fourth season with recurring characters, but other links aren't as obvious.
